LIKE A BAVARIAN HUNTING LODGE 11/15/2006

You feel as if you've stepped into an old hunting lodge in Bavaria after you enter this German restaurant. A dark wood interior with crafted beams and deer and boars heads mounted on the walls. Waitresses wear traditional dirndles in this warm and cozy atmosphere. I've been to Deutschland and this food is very authentic! Huge portions (try the Jaeger Schnitzel) along with an impressive selection of fine German beer (Spaten Oktoberfest). It's hard to leave room for dessert - we were actually too stuffed the last time we were there, however, the table next to ours ordered the apple strudle and it both looked and smelled delicious! Prost! Pros: Food, beer & atmosphere Cons: Located out in Queens, but, worth the trip more

  • This Glendale, Queens' restaurant, with its kitschy Bavarian decor and cemetery-adjacent location, is a quirky place to enjoy a stein of beer and hearty German fare.
